Tyler Hansbrough, Ty Lawson and Wayne Ellington are still unsure about whether or not they want to enter their names in the NBA Draft, according to head men's basketball coach Roy Williams.

Addressing the media after the team's awards ceremony Thursday night at the Smith Center, Williams said that none of the players would speak to the media to talk about their decisions because none of them had reached one as of yet.

Underclassmen have until April 27th to enter their names in the NBA Draft pool. Players that enter their names have until June 16th to withdraw themselves from consideration.

Tha NBA Draft will take place June 26 in New York City.

The Carolina players might not be first-round selections, and may be weighing where they would fall as other players announce their decisions.

However, the fact that the players did not announce a decision Thursday is a sign that they are seriously considering the draft. Last year, both Hansbrough and Lawson said at the awards ceremony they intended to return.
